Frequently Asked Questions about Harbor Park

What type of rentals are currently available in Harbor Park?

There are currently 284 Apartments for Rent in Harbor Park, VA with pricing that ranges from $900 to $4,989. There are also 59 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Harbor Park ranging from $600 to $4,250.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Harbor Park?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Harbor Park ranges from $600 to $4,250 with an average monthly rent of $2,150.
